Tiramisu: Classic Irresistible Recipe
Classic Tiramisu is made with layers of coffee-soaked ladyfingers, sweet and creamy mascarpone (no raw eggs!), and topped cocoa powder. Its a no bake dessert and can be made in advance for future use!

- 1 1/2 cups heavy whipping cream
- 8 ounce mascarpone cheese room temperature
- 1/3 cup white sugar
- 1 tbsp Vanilla extract
- 1 1/2 cups espresso cold
- 1 package lady fingers
- Cocoa powder for dusting
Bring a mixing bowl and beat whipping cream on medium speed, slowly add vanilla extract and white sugar and continue to beat until stiff peaks. Now add mascarpone cheese and combine it well. Let it aside.
Add coffee to a shallow bowl and dip the lady fingers in it (quickly dip them on both side and lay them on bottom of an 8x8” or pan of same size.)
Add half of the mascarpone mixture on the top, add layer of dipped ladyfingers, after that smoothly add remaining mascarpone cream on top.
Finish it with cocoa dust smoothly over to the top.
Retrograde for minimum 5 hours before serving.
Alcohol: Tiramisu is made with or without alcohol, its main ingredient is coffee, as its coffee flavored dessert just make sure its extra strong.
Make Ahead: This recipe is even better if you make it ahead of time, allowing all flavor to completely blend in! it can be refrigerated for 2-3 days.
Freezing Instructions: you can freeze this treat. Prepare a wrap and store tiramisu in plastic wrap layer and then another layer of alum foil. It can be freeze for up to 3 months, before using thaw it well in fridge for one night.
